Located just south of Baseline Road between 47th and 51st Avenues, Country Glen is an intimate and established subdivision around 8 miles southwest of downtown Phoenix. Built between 2002 and 2004, the community comprises approximately 350 attached and single-family residences—ranging from townhomes to 5-bedroom homes—creating a diverse neighborhood ideal for families, young professionals, and downsizers.


🌳 Community Design & Amenities

  • Home Styles & Sizes
    The neighborhood offers a mix of home types: cozy townhomes (~1,500 sq ft, 3-bedroom) and larger single-family houses up to ~2,500 sq ft with 4–5 bedrooms, accommodating a range of household needs.

  • Green Spaces
    Although Country Glen doesn’t have a central park, wide sidewalks and smaller landscaped pockets throughout offer safe walking paths and gathering spots. Many homeowners enhance their yards with trees, gardens, and gazebo areas for backyard living.

  • Trails & Outdoor Access
    Paved sidewalks connect with regional trails that lead toward South Mountain Park & Preserve, giving residents easy access to more than 50 miles of hiking, biking, and riding paths just a short drive away.


📍 Located in the Heart of Laveen

  • Position in Laveen
    Nestled between 47th and 51st Avenues and south of Baseline, Country Glen enables a tranquil setting while keeping you close to major routes.

  • Quick Commutes
    Easy access to Baseline Road, Loop 202, and I‑10 ensures smooth trips to Phoenix, Sky Harbor Airport, Tempe, and beyond.

  • Local Conveniences
    Grocery stores, medical offices, coffee shops, eateries, fitness centers, and schools are all nearby—perfect for those juggling busy daily schedules.

  • Top School District Access
    Zoned for the Laveen Elementary School District (Cheatham, Trailside Point, etc.) and the Phoenix Union High School District, Country Glen is well-positioned for families.
